As He began His ministry, Jesus was about 30 years old and was thought to be the

son of Joseph, son of Heli,

son of Matthat, son of Levi,
son of Melchi, son of Jannai,
son of Joseph,

son of Mattathias,
son of Amos, son of Nahum,
son of Esli, son of Naggai,

son of Maath, son of Mattathias,
son of Semein, son of Josech,
son of Joda,

son of Joanan,
son of Rhesa, son of Zerubbabel,
son of Shealtiel, son of Neri,

son of Melchi, son of Addi,
son of Cosam, son of Elmadam,
son of Er,

son of Joshua,
son of Eliezer, son of Jorim,
son of Matthat, son of Levi,

son of Simeon, son of Judah,
son of Joseph, son of Jonam,
son of Eliakim,

son of Melea,
son of Menna, son of Mattatha,
son of Nathan, son of David,

son of Jesse, son of Obed,
son of Boaz, son of Salmon,
son of Nahshon,

son of Amminadab,
son of Ram, son of Hezron,
son of Perez, son of Judah,

son of Jacob, son of Isaac,
son of Abraham, son of Terah,
son of Nahor,

son of Serug,
son of Reu, son of Peleg,
son of Eber, son of Shelah,

son of Cainan, son of Arphaxad,
son of Shem, son of Noah,
son of Lamech,

son of Methuselah,
son of Enoch, son of Jared,
son of Mahalaleel, son of Cainan,

son of Enos, son of Seth,
son of Adam, son of God.
